About the role

Job Description

  • Responsible for performing a variety of technical support duties in one or more manufacturing areas, which may involve working with and assisting engineers.

  • Duties may be related to the selection, Assembly, repair and support of manufacturing equipment; technical support of one or more production/fabrication processes, product testing and troubleshooting; and/or technical analyses and problem-solving.

  • Carries out and/or assists in the development, improvement and optimization of standards, processes and procedures in the manufacturing environment, which may include cycle-time, yield, unit cost, quality, safety and compliance.

  • Works with engineers to develop, execute and track the testing and problem resolution of new and existing components, parts, products or processes/systems.

  • Perform mechanical and electrical assembly, installation, repair, and packaging of parts/equipment within designated manufacturing areas.

  • Carry out technical duties and daily production tasks that require planning, judgment, and problem-solving skills.

  • Conduct tests, experiments, and troubleshooting activities related to components, parts, products, and manufacturing systems.

  • Adhere to established safety protocols, operational procedures, and production schedules to ensure timely and compliant output.

  • Maintain a clean, organized, and compliant work environment in accordance with 5S and/or GMP standards.

  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to support efficient workflow, rapid issue resolution, and smooth overall operations.

Qualifications

  • May require some higher education or specialized training/certification, or equivalent combination of education and experience.

  • Typically minimum of 3 years relevant experience for entry to this level.

  • Requires complete understanding of general and technical aspects of job.
